In West Palm Beach, your lawn is always “on.” Warm air off the water, quick afternoon storms, sandy soils, sprinklers, and mild winters mean grass never really goes fully dormant, and neither do weeds. One month your yard looks clean, and the next you’re seeing dollarweed shining after every rain, sedges poking up taller than the turf, and random patches that just don’t match the rest of the lawn. Those weeds don’t just spoil the view from the street; they rob your grass of water and nutrients and slowly wear down your curb appeal.

Types of Weeds We Control in the West Palm Beach Area

Our climate invites a mix of grassy weeds, broadleaf weeds, and moisture-loving troublemakers. Common invaders we see across West Palm Beach include:

- Dollarweed, thriving in damp or overwatered areas
- Crabgrass and other grassy weeds creeping into thin or sunbaked patches
- Nutsedge, popping up faster and taller than your regular turf
- Spurge, hugging the ground along driveways, walkways, and pool decks
- Chamberbitter and other broadleaf weeds that appear in clusters seemingly overnight

Some weeds spread across the surface, while others keep returning from deeper roots or favorable soil conditions. That’s why proper identification comes first, we treat what you actually have, not what you think it might be.

Preventative Weed Control & Pre-Emergent Treatments

The best weed is the one that never gets the chance to sprout. Pre-emergent weed control forms a barrier in the soil that helps stop many weed seeds from germinating.

By pairing pre-emergent treatments with smart watering, fertilization, and mowing practices, we help you spend less time fighting full-blown infestations and more time simply maintaining a good-looking lawn.

In West Palm Beach, prevention matters because:

  • Weeds can germinate almost year-round in warm soil
  • Irrigation and afternoon storms create ideal conditions for new weeds
  • Bare or thin areas become weed patches very quickly
